Old school dim sum restaurant located in Dragon City. It's been around for a while, lots of locals; a lot of older Chinese people and families, especially on the weekends. It's one of the few dim sum restaurants where they still push the dim sum carts around. You can order ... from both the dim sum carts and from the menu via your server. The decor is old, probably hasn't been renovated since it opened but works for an old school dim sum spot. They do the classic dim sum dishes like Siu Mai, rice noodles rolls, and congee pretty well. Their ha gow isn't bad either, but the skin is a bit too thick. I would avoid the fried food here, they don't do that very well, the oil isn't hot enough, their fried dishes are on the soggy side, like the squid tentacle and salt and pepper shrimp was underwhelming. The price point is good for dim sum in Chinatown, in comparison to the other dim sum spots nearby. They're definitely more competitively priced. Bill was $120 for 5 people. Overall still a dim sum spot that I would be happy to visit again, but would stick to more classic dishes and avoid the fried ones. Read more

Sky Dragon Chinese Restaurant is a lively dim sum go-to eatery located on the 4th floor of the Dragon City Mall, serving traditional Chinese food options with a patio overlooking the beautiful city views. This restaurant has been in business for many many years, I always heard about its existence but ... just never got the chance to go all the way up to the 4th floor to try it. I came here for my 1st time after getting regular blood test on the 3rd floor lab, may as well check this resto out. Moment I walked in, I have to say, you could tell the building and the restaurant is aging, things seem old including the table cloth and the chairs. But it does its job I guess. I really find it fascinating that this resto has a nice patio overlooking our beautiful skyline. You could even spot the CN Tower from here. They have a few tables for those who wants to dine outside. The service here was good though, the staff were friendly to me. They asked me for my choice of Chinese tea and then provided me with a big Dim Sum menu that shows pics of each dish. I ordered my favourite Har Gao (steam shrimp dumplings), Shui Mai (steam pork dumplings) + a bowl of shredded pork century egg congee + a stir fry bean sprouts ho fun. When the dishes arrived at my table, they were big portion and I couldn't finish them and had to ask for take out boxes. They were tasty and delicious. I really enjoyed the congee in particular as it provided some crunchy fried stuff on the top with chopped green onions. Prices were decent as well as they charged you Dim Sum based on small, medium, large, extra large or special. Most Dim Sum items are reasonable at medium or large or extra large. NOTE: Whenever you go to Dim Sum, they normally charge you for the tea per person. I know many wouldn't notice until the bill arrives. But that makes sense as they specially provide a Chinese tea that you asked for and a teapot specially for you. When you go to a regular restaurant, they do charge you for a tea/coffee, same deal. Normally, they charge between $1.50 CDN/person to $2.00 CDN/person for Chinese tea at Chinese restaurants, which is reasonable. Read more
